lipid bilayer [¦lip·id ′bī‚lā·ər]
(cell and molecular biology)
The foundational structure of plasma membranes; it is composed of two layers of phospholipids positioned such that their polar hydrophilic heads face outward and their nonpolar hydrophobic tails are directed inward, blocking entry of water and water-soluble material into the cell.
